[QUOTE=JACKROXYOU]yea so how are the dvds[/QUOTE]
The Last Supper - Excellent concert footage, excellent interviews Never Say Die - Its alright, not amazing though The Black Sabbath Story Vol.1 - Again its alright, nothing too special. The Black Sabbath Story Vol.2 - Alot worse than Vol.1, seems to have been rushed. Inside Black Sabbath - 1970 - 1992 - Its basicly the Sabbath story Vols 1 + 2 on one DVD with some added Tony Martin years footage. Good stuff. Out of that list, the ones to get are The Last Supper and Inside Black Sabbath 1970 - 1992. The rest are more of a hardcore fan's collection. Oh yeh.. I have all those DVD's :) |
